BTS650PE3230 Overview

Buffer/Inverter Based Peripheral Driver, 240A, MOS, PSFM7

BTS650PE3230 Parametric

Parameter NameAttribute value
MakerSIEMENS
package instruction,
Reach Compliance Codeunknown
ECCN codeEAR99
Is SamacsysN
Built-in protectionOVER CURRENT; OVER VOLTAGE; THERMAL
Input propertiesSTANDARD
Interface integrated circuit typeBUFFER OR INVERTER BASED PERIPHERAL DRIVER
JESD-30 codeR-PSFM-T7
Number of functions1
Number of terminals7
Output characteristicsOPEN-SOURCE
Output current flow directionSOURCE
Nominal output peak current240 A
Output polarityTRUE
Package body materialPLASTIC/EPOXY
Package shapeRECTANGULAR
Package formFLANGE MOUNT
Certification statusNot Qualified
Maximum supply voltage34 V
Minimum supply voltage4 V
Nominal supply voltage12 V
surface mountNO
technologyMOS
Terminal formTHROUGH-HOLE
Terminal locationSINGLE
Disconnect time180 µs
connection time320 µs
Base Number Matches1
